LSU Rural Life Museum
Step back in time at the LSU Rural Life Museum, an outdoor living history museum showcasing 19th-century Louisiana plantation life. Explore preserved buildings, artifacts, and exhibits that vividly depict the daily routines and social structures of the era. It's an engaging way to spend a few hours, offering a unique educational experience that complements academic pursuits by providing historical context. The museum is a short drive from the center and offers a fascinating glimpse into the region's past.

Weather & Seasons at Mcauliffe Pre-Ged Center
- Winter: Winter in Baton Rouge typically brings mild temperatures, with average highs in the 60s Fahrenheit. While cool days are common, significant cold snaps are infrequent. Visitors should pack layers, including light jackets or sweaters, as mornings can be chilly. Outdoor activities are generally comfortable, but it's wise to check the forecast for any unpredictable cold fronts.
- Spring & early summer: Spring ushers in warm and increasingly humid conditions, with temperatures rising into the 70s and 80s. This is a beautiful time to visit, as blooming flora adds color to the landscape. Lightweight clothing is recommended, and light rain showers are common, so carrying a compact umbrella is advisable for impromptu downpours.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is characterized by intense heat and high humidity, with temperatures frequently reaching the 90s Fahrenheit and feeling even hotter. Daily afternoon thunderstorms are a common occurrence, offering temporary relief but often followed by more muggy air. Staying hydrated and seeking air-conditioned environments during peak heat is essential. Lightweight, breathable fabrics are a must for comfort.
- Fall season: Fall offers a welcome respite from summer humidity, with temperatures becoming more moderate and comfortable, typically in the 60s and 70s. This season is ideal for exploring the city and enjoying outdoor spaces. Layers remain a good choice as days can still be warm, but evenings may require a light sweater or jacket.
- Rain & snow: Rainfall is consistent throughout the year in Baton Rouge, with heavier amounts expected during spring and summer thunderstorm seasons. Snow is rare and typically does not accumulate. Visitors should always be prepared for rain, especially during the warmer months, and pack waterproof outerwear or an umbrella to stay dry during short, intense showers.
